Lethbridge, AB – The Two Guys and a Pizza Place Pronghorn Athletes of the Week for the week ending November 19, 2017.
 
Female Athlete of the Week:
Kacie Bosch – Women’s Basketball
 
 
Continuing with her team’s exceptional start to the season, point guard Kacie Bosch led the way as the Pronghorn women’s basketball team moved to 8-0 in conference action for the first time in program history following a road sweep of the Thompson Rivers WolfPack.
 
Friday night, the Chinook High School grad scored 14 points on an efficient 6 of 10 shooting, including hitting on both of her three pointers in the Pronghorns 73-53 win over the WolfPack. She also recorded seven rebounds, three steals and one assist.
 
The next night, Bosch led all scorers with 19 points, to go along with five rebounds, two steals and another assist in the Pronghorns 79-59 win.
 
On the season, Bosch leads the Pronghorns in scoring with 12 points per game, while also averaging 5.6 rebounds, 2.5 assists and two steals a night.
 
This coming weekend, the Pronghorns will travel to Regina to face the top ranked Regina Cougars.
 
Male Athlete of the Week:
Mitch Maxwell – Men’s Hockey
 
Putting an end to an extended losing streak, Lethbridge Pronghorn men’s hockey Captain Mitch Maxwell led by example, collecting six points in two games as the Pronghorns swept the Manitoba Bisons with a pair of 4-3 overtime wins.
 
Friday night, the Magrath, Alberta product had a hand in all four goals as the Pronghorns battled back from a one-goal deficit on three separate occasions to snap an eight-game losing streak with a 4-3 overtime win.
 
Maxwell forced overtime with a third period marker and picked up three assists.
 
The next day, Maxwell scored the game winning goal only 17-seconds into the extra frame to give the Pronghorns their first weekend sweep of the season. He also picked up an assist, recorded three shots on goal and was a plus one.
 
On the season, Maxwell now sits in a tie for third on the conference scoring list with six goals and 11 assists.
 
This coming weekend, Maxwell and the Pronghorns head out on the road, traveling to Regina to face the Regina Cougars.
